How Washington’s Rainy Climate Impacts Commercial Roof Longevity

Flat commercial roof in an urban setting with a clear view of surrounding architecture and blue skies, illustrating considerations for roof longevity in Washington's varied climate

Washington’s rainy climate significantly affects the lifespan of commercial roofs. Understanding these impacts and implementing preventive measures can help extend your roof’s durability and ensure long-term performance.

Moisture Intrusion and Water Damage

Persistent rainfall can penetrate even minor vulnerabilities in roofing materials, leading to water damage. Once water seeps in, it can harm the roof deck, insulation, and even the building’s interior.

Preventive Measure:

Schedule regular roof inspections to identify and repair vulnerabilities before moisture intrusion occurs. Maintain gutters and downspouts to ensure proper drainage and prevent water accumulation that can exacerbate these issues.

Mold and Mildew Growth

Washington’s damp environment creates ideal conditions for mold and mildew growth, which can weaken roofing materials and pose health risks to building occupants.

Preventive Measure:

Ensure proper ventilation to reduce moisture buildup. Regularly clean and inspect the roof to detect and address mold growth promptly.

Structural Stress from Standing Water

Flat roofs on commercial buildings face unique challenges, particularly with water accumulation. Unlike sloped roofs, flat roofs don’t naturally shed water, increasing the risk of leaks and structural damage when water pools on the surface.

Preventive Measure:

Enhance drainage systems to facilitate water runoff. Regularly maintain gutters and drains to prevent blockages that lead to standing water.

Accelerated Material Deterioration

Continuous exposure to heavy rainfall can wear down roofing materials over time. Water infiltration can cause cracks and leaks, compromising the roof’s integrity.

Preventive Measure:

Apply protective coatings to enhance water resistance. Opt for durable materials designed for high-moisture environments to mitigate deterioration.

Wind-Driven Rain Complications

Wind-driven rain can force moisture into seams and beneath roofing materials, leading to leaks and water damage. This combination of wind and rain accelerates wear and tear on commercial roofs.

Preventive Measure:

Secure roofing materials and ensure all seams are properly sealed. Regular inspections can identify areas vulnerable to wind-driven rain intrusion.

Conclusion

Washington’s rainy climate poses several challenges to commercial roof longevity, including moisture intrusion, mold growth, standing water stress, material deterioration, and wind-driven rain complications. Implementing regular maintenance and preventive measures can help mitigate these issues, ensuring your commercial roof remains durable and effective.
